  • Interest, Unlawful – Profit Making, Lawful … Why?

    Published on : 09 06 2011

    Muslims believe that paying or receiving riba (interest/usury) is forbidden in Islam, while gaining profit in lawful business transactions is fully permitted. What is the difference?Many may think that lending money at a high interest is unjust, but in Islam, lending money on interest at any rate is unacceptable.
